Unsaturated linear polyesters
First Claim
1. An unsaturated, flame-retardant, linear polyester consisting essentially in the total condensed acid component of at least 20 mol % of an unsaturated dicarboxylic acid selected from the group consisting of maleic, fumaric, itaconic, citraconic and dimethylmaleic acids and up to 80 mol % of a saturated aromatic or aliphatic dicarboxylic acid selected from the group consisting of phthalic, terephthalic, isophthalic, 2,5-dibromoterephthalic, succinic, glutaric, adipic, pimelic, suberic, azelaic and sebacic acids;
- and in the total condensed diol component of at least 18 mol % of a brominated or of at least 47 mol % of a chlorinated benzimidazolone diol of formula I ##EQU6## wherein X independently denotes bromine or chlorine, R1 and R1 '"'"' each denotes hydrogen, methyl, ethyl or phenyl, and R2 and R2 '"'"' each denotes hydrogen or R1 together with R2 and R1 '"'"' together with R2 '"'"' each denote trimethylene or tetramethylene;
the amount of diol of formula I incorporated in said polyester being that required to bring the bromine content of said polyester to at least 15 weight % or the chlorine content to at least 20 weight %; and
with the remaining condensed diol component selected from the group consisting of ethylene glycol, diethylene glycol, polyethylene glycol of up to 24 carbon atoms, propylene glycol, dipropylene glycol, polypropylene glycol of up to 24 carbon atoms, 1,4-butanediol, 1,12-dodecanediol, neopentyl glycol and 1,4-cyclohexanediol.

Abstract
Unsaturated, linear polyesters having flame-retarding properties are obtained by polycondensing unsaturated dicarboxylic acids, optionally mixed with aromatic dicarboxylic acids and aliphatic diols, with brominated and/or chlorinated 1,3-di-(hydroxyalkyl)-benzimidazolone compounds. The new, unsaturated polyesters can be polymerized easily, also when mixed with other polymerizable monomers, and give moulding materials having flame-retarding properties.
